Ben & Jerry’s Free Cone Day: April 4, 2017

Stop by your local Ben & Jerry’s Scoop Shop for a free cone on April 4.

I scream, you scream, we all scream for free ice cream!

Mark your calendars because Ben & Jerry’s just announced its global Free Cone Day. On Tuesday, April 4 from 12-8pm, Ben & Jerry’s lovers can wait on line for a free cone of their favorite flavor or try something new—no Fairtrade concoction is off limits.

Free Cone Day started in 1979 when co-founders Ben Cohen and Jerry Greenfield celebrated their first year in business in Burlington, VT. They decided to thank the community, who helped the fledgling business survive, by giving out free scoops. In 1993, Free Cone Day became a national celebration, and in 2000, Scoop Shops around the world joined in to make Free Cone Day a global event.

“We believe in having fun, and in thanking our fans with free ice cream for our anniversary every year,” said Ben & Jerry’s CEO Jostein Solheim in a press release. “Through the power of ice cream, we are able to form strong connections and create positive social change together. Free Cone Day is one way to show our fans how much we appreciate them.”

While last year’s Free Cone Day focused on raising awareness for climate justice, this year’s celebration is focused on fun and Fairtrade, a movement working to ensure that small-scale farmers in developing nations can succeed in the global marketplace. Ben & Jerry’s currently sources five Fairtrade Certified ingredients: sugar, cocoa, vanilla, coffee, and bananas, according to benjerry.com.
